In the bustling rhythm of modern commerce, truck drivers are the unsung heroes who keep the lifeblood of the economy flowing. They embody a blend of grit, resilience, and dedication, maneuvering through countless miles of highway and countless challenges. As they roll across the sprawling landscapes of America, each journey tells a story—each driver, a trailblazer paving the way for the future of transport.


The Dawn of a New Day


For many truck drivers, the day begins before dawn. Alarm clocks buzz at 4 a.m., cutting through the quiet of the night, beckoning them to rise and shine. A quick breakfast—often a coffee and a protein bar—serves as fuel for the long hours ahead.


“By the time the sun rises, I’m already on the road. It’s my time to think and prepare for the day ahead,” says Linda, a seasoned truck driver with over a decade of experience.

As Linda preps her rig, she performs a thorough inspection of the vehicle. Checking the engine, lights, and tires is critical, ensuring her safety and that of others on the road. Each of these checks is crucially important; in fact, the Department of Transportation mandates regular inspections, reflecting the commitment to safety that every driver upholds.


The Open Road


With the truck loaded and the GPS set, Linda merges onto the interstate, the open road stretching ahead of her. The freedom of the road is intoxicating yet sobering. Truckers often travel thousands of miles each week, navigating highways and back roads, through bustling cities and lonely stretches of rural America.


As she drives, Linda listens to podcasts and audiobooks, enjoying everything from true crime stories to motivational talks. The open road provides ample time for reflection and growth, as well as a chance to foster a sense of community through these shared narratives. The camaraderie among truckers—whether through CB radios or online forums—creates a supportive environment in an often-isolated profession.

Navigating Challenges


Truck driving is undoubtedly rewarding, yet it comes with its fair share of challenges. Long hours on the road can lead to fatigue, which poses significant risks. According to the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ration, driver fatigue is a leading cause of accidents involving large trucks. To combat this, drivers like Linda adhere to strict regulations about driving hours and rest breaks.


Traffic congestion, unpredictable weather, and tight deadlines add another layer of complexity. Linda recounts a day when unexpected rain created hazardous conditions: “I had to slow down significantly, and at one point, I could barely see the road. It was nerve-wracking, but you learn to adapt—your safety and that of others depends on it.”


“We are the backbone of the economy. If we stop, everything stops,” she adds, emphasizing the importance of the trucking industry.

Community on Wheels


Despite the hurdles, there’s a sense of unity among truckers. Truck stops become social hubs where drivers can meet, share stories, and refuel both their vehicles and themselves. From diners offering hearty meals to places where drivers can shower and rest, these stops foster a unique camaraderie.


Linda often connects with fellow drivers at these stops. “It’s amazing how much support and friendship can be found among total strangers,” she explains. “We’re all in this together, navigating the same challenges and celebrating our victories, no matter how small.”


The Art of Homecoming


After a long day of driving, returning home is a bittersweet moment. For truck drivers, home is often a fleeting destination. The road can pull them away for days, sometimes weeks, at a time. Linda shares, “The hardest part is missing out on family moments, birthdays, and holidays. But the excitement of returning home is what fuels me.”

Family support is vital in this profession. Many drivers rely on technology to stay connected with loved ones while on the road. Video calls during breaks and regular texts help bridge the distance, making the truck feel less lonely. Family members also play an essential role in encouraging drivers to stay healthy and balanced, reminding them to take breaks and practice self-care.


The Future of Truck Driving


The landscape of truck driving is evolving rapidly, with advancements in technology transforming the industry. Autonomous trucks promise to revolutionize the profession, presenting both opportunities and concerns for drivers like Linda. “I believe there will always be a place for human drivers,” she asserts, “There are nuances to driving that machines just can’t replicate.”


Environmental awareness is also becoming a significant focus, with many companies exploring electric and alternative fuel vehicles. The move toward sustainability is reshaping how drivers and companies approach their roles in an ever-changing world.


Conclusion


In a day in the life of a truck driver, determination, community, and resilience are the undercurrents. Drivers like Linda are not merely transporting goods; they are forging connections and bridging distances, embodying the spirit of exploration and freedom on the open road.


As they navigate through challenges and embrace triumphs, these trailblazing individuals remind us that the journey often matters as much as the destination. Truck drivers are the backbone of the economy, and through their stories, they continue to inspire generations to come.
